Crime overview

Hall Street area has the 3rd highest crime rate of 44 local areas in St. James's , and the 47th highest crime rate of 1,019 local areas in Dudley .

Crime levels at this postcode are much higher than in the adjoining streets, suggesting that most neighbouring areas are relatively safer than this one.

The overall crime rate in the area around Hall Street (DY2 7BS) in the last 12 months was 273.4 per 1,000 residents and was 68.5% higher than the St. James's average (162.3 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Shoplifting with 60 offences recorded. The least common crime was Burglary with 1 case , down -66.7% compared to 2024. The fastest-growing crime category was Drugs ( 200.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Burglary ( -66.7%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 28 (≈ 69.0 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were rising ( 16.7%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-30.0%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around Hall Street (DY2 7BS), the main crime hotspot is near Castle Street. Police recorded 190 crimes here, including 58 violent or public-order offences. All these locations are within roughly 0.3 miles.
